Ski and Trek launch new website designed by I-COM

Ski and Trek, the online ski wear and outdoor clothing and equipment retailer, has launched a new website designed by online marketing specialist I-COM.

Manchester based I-COM was briefed to refresh the company’s existing website and introduce new social media elements as Ski and Trek moves from being a mainly discount-led retailer to building relationships with customers.

Social elements include online geo-tagged reviews of walks and hikes that have been tackled by the Ski and Trek community were added to the website as well as the Facebook, Twitter and Flickr presence being expanded.

Next for the brand is adding an F-commerce element to Ski and Trek’s revamped Facebook page and integrating it into the online store available at the main website, as well as an SEO and PPC campaign.

As part of the launch campaign for the new Ski and Trek site, the retailer is running an online competition for customers with a first prize of a 10-day ski holiday in the Canadian Rockies on offer.

Mike Blackburn, I-COM operations director, said: “This kind of back end integration between F-commerce and the main e-commerce site is more usually found with larger retailers, because it can be expensive.

“But I-COM has developed a way to provide this functionality at far less cost, opening up new opportunities for small to medium-sized online retailers who want to make maximum use of Facebook, as well as their own website.

“The Ski and Trek story is similar to many I-COM clients. We don’t just build websites or develop SEO campaigns, we use technology to help businesses improve and grow.”
